DROP SEQUENCE
Function
DROP SEQUENCE deletes a sequence from the current database.
Precautions
Only the sequence owner or a user granted with the DROP permission can run the DROP SEQUENCE command. The system administrator has this permission by default.
Syntax
DROP SEQUENCE [ IF EXISTS ] {[schema.]sequence_name} [ , ... ] [ CASCADE | RESTRICT ];
Parameter Description
IF EXISTS
Reports a notice instead of an error if the specified sequence does not exist.
name
Specifies the name of the sequence to be deleted.
CASCADE
Automatically deletes the objects that depend on the sequence.
RESTRICT
Refuses to delete the sequence if any objects depend on it. This is the default action.
Examples
-- Create an ascending sequence named serial, starting from 101.
postgres=# CREATE SEQUENCE serial START 101;
-- Delete a sequence.
postgres=# DROP SEQUENCE serial;
